Overview

Specialise in environmental and sustainable processes while developing the technical, professional and digital skills needed in industry.

Our course is for engineers and scientists who want to make a positive impact on the environment, society and the future of our planet. Climate change, GHG emissions and loss of biodiversity are important global issues and the world needs leaders and innovators to design and manage sustainable processes and systems to address these.

If you have that desire to learn how to solve the important environmental challenges we face, then our course can help you towards that goal. We’ll develop your skills, knowledge and understanding to take on these issues against a backdrop of economic factors, environmental compliance and national and international legislation.

Your studies will cover areas such as improving resource efficiency, and how to monitor, manage and mitigate negative environmental consequences. You’ll learn how to apply whole-systems and life-cycle approaches to evaluate the impact of industrial activities while considering current and possible future legislation. This ‘big-picture thinking’ will allow you to move beyond traditional approaches to process engineering.

As part of your learning experience, we make sure you have the opportunity to develop useful skills in areas such as interdisciplinary teamwork, effective communication, networking and time resource management. This will help prepare you to adapt and be successful in a variety of roles in this evolving discipline.

Work Permit United Kingdom

There are various options through which a student can get a post study work visa in the UK. 
Tier 1 Graduate Entrepreneur Visa for the graduates with a genuine and credible business idea. 
Tier 2 (General) is the leading immigration visa to work in the UK.
Tier 4 Doctorate Extension Scheme is for students who have completed their Ph.D. and is valid for 12 months for them to work, look for work or set up a business. 
Tier 5 Youth Mobility is for individuals of certain countries like Australia, Canada, Japan, Monaco, Hong Kong, South Korea, Taiwan, and New Zealand aged between 18 -30 who wish to move to the UK. 
Tier 5 GAE is for individuals who want to come to the UK for work experience, training, research or a fellowship. 
UK Ancestry is for individuals who are a citizen of a commonwealth and plan to work in the UK and have a grandparent who was born in the UK.

Develop the skills to resolve complex economic issues. Learn economic theories, methods and applications, and become acquainted with chosen specialist areas.

In this course, you’ll study the foundations of economic theory and its applications to real-world problems. You’ll explore the connections between the economy as a whole, its main sectors (such as businesses, the financial sector, government, for example) and the decisions of individuals.

You’ll learn how to apply economic principles and methods to policy issues. You’ll develop your knowledge of institutions to understand how economic decisions and policies are made.

Your first year is concerned with key concepts in microeconomic and macroeconomic theory. You’ll further your skills in core mathematics, statistics and data analysis. In Year 2, you’ll build on this through intermediate study of economic theory. The study of econometrics will enable you to estimate and forecast economic relationships. The final year will teach you advanced economic theory. A selection of optional units will enable you to tailor your expertise to your personal interests and career aspirations.

Placement Year

Taking a placement in your third year enables you to use the theory you have learnt in a practical context. You will learn about an organisation and its area of work in the UK or overseas. This is an excellent opportunity to test potential career paths. Sometimes permanent jobs are offered to our students. You’ll develop skills such as teamwork, planning, problem solving, decision making and project management.

Employers value a year of professional work and you’ll gain an advantage in the job market. Sometimes it is possible for you to acquire additional professional qualifications, particularly in accountancy, whilst on placement.

Year abroad

On this course you'll combine a work placement with studying at a university overseas. Broaden your horizons and experience another culture whilst studying a course that complements your studies at Bath.

Study abroad locations include the National University of Singapore and Stellenbosch University (South Africa), as well as others. We seek to further expand on these. Study abroad opportunities are limited and are subject to availability at our partner institutions.
